2011-10-11 50 views
0

如何在第6列第一行中將值從xt更新到xtt。使用VBA更新特定行上的列值

1 2 3 4 5 6 

x xx xy xz x1 xt 

y yx tt cc z3 xcc 

基於上述數據,我從工作表中獲取範圍。獲取對象後,如何更新特定列中的單元格值?

回答

1

至於問,你可以使用方法更新特定列:

'Sheet.Cells(row, column) = value 
' i.e. 
ActiveSheet.Cells(1, 6) = "xtt" 

如果只想執行更新,如果它具有的「XT」的值,那麼顯然你需要檢查執行更新之前的內容...例如:

If (ActiveSheet.Cells(1, 6) = "xt") Then 
    ActiveSheet.Cells(1, 6) = "xtt" 
End If 
+0

:我更新了我的問題,獲取行對象後,我想更新單元格值 – Raj

相關問題